A skill for writing pull requests, which are proposals to merge code changes into a shared repository, according to Sentry's conventions.

In plain words
What is it for?
It is for creating or updating pull requests with the expected structure and references.
Why use it?
It helps keep pull request titles, descriptions, and issue references consistent and clear for reviewers.

Token cost

What it costs to keep this loaded

Counted locally with the o200k_base tokenizer, which is exact for GPT models; Claude uses its own tokenizer and its counts differ. Treat this as one consistent yardstick across the catalogue rather than a bill. Prices are per million input tokens.

ModelPer sessionOnce invoked
Fable 5 $0.00056 $0.01230
Opus 5 $0.00028 $0.00615
Sonnet 5 $0.00011 $0.00246
Haiku 4.5 $0.00006 $0.00123

Measured yesterday against content hash 1b52e2c8726d, method: parsed. Prices are Anthropic first-party input rates as of 2026-08-30, from the pricing page.

Security

Grade A, and why

pr-writer sc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ured yesterday.

A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.

Nothing flagged

None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.
